CVT Start Clutch Calibration Procedures



Start Clutch Calibration Procedures

When the following the parts are replaced, the PCM must memorize the feedback signal for the start clutch control.

^ PCM
^ Transmission assembly
^ Lower valve body assembly
^ Engine assembly replacement or overhaul

1. Start the engine, and warm up to normal operating temperature (the radiator fan comes on).

2. Shift to the D position.

3. Drive the vehicle on a flat road.

4. Accelerate to the speed 37 mph (60 km/h), then release the accelerator and decelerate for 5 seconds. Do not press the brake pedal to decelerate. The start clutch feedback control signal have been memorized in the PCM.

5. Test-drive the vehicle and check the engine does not stall and the vehicle can start off smoothly.

6. If the engine stalls or any shifting failure occurs at starting off, re-calibrate the start clutch feedback control signal.
